Can dogs have brown rice - Cooking Brown Rice for Dogs. To prepare brown rice for your pet, use a ratio of 2 cups of water for every 1 cup of rice. Rinse the rice thoroughly before cooking to remove any debris. Bring the water to a boil, add the rice, and reduce the heat to low. Cover the pot and let the rice cook for 45-50 minutes, or until all the water is absorbed.

Additionally, rice flour contains essential nutrients such as vitamins B3 and B6 that benefit your pup’s overall health.Dogs can safely digest rice, says Ann Wortinger, a veterinary technician specialist in the field of nutrition. Like people, dogs have amylase, an enzyme that breaks down starches like rice.
